FDA Drug recall D-760-2013

MICC (Methionine, Inositol, Choline, Cyanocobalamin, Chromium) Inj and MICC 25/50/330 Inj, compounded by Olympia Pharmacy, Orlando, FL

On 2013-07-17 the FDA classified a Class II recall of MICC (Methionine, Inositol, Choline, Cyanocobalamin, Chromium) Inj and MICC 25/50/330 Inj, compounded by Olympia Pharmacy, Orlando, FL by Lowlite Investments, citing lack of Assurance of Sterility: FDA inspection findings resulted in concerns regarding quality control processes.
